Position Summary: MidAmerica Nazarene University seeks a part-time Pioneer Trek Director/Coordinator for Global Missions Engagement to support MNU-based academic and missions projects aligned with Nazarene Global Missions priorities. This grant-funded position will direct Pioneer Trek faculty-led projects, student participation, communication, logistics, and reporting, working in close coordination with our partners at Mount Vernon Nazarene University and the Nazarene Global Missions team.
This is a part-time, grant-funded position of up to 20 hours per week and is currently funded through the 2028-2029 academic year.

Statement of Faith: MidAmerica Nazarene University is an intentionally Christian Community and desires that all employees in positions of leadership reflect a foundational Christian position in word, attitude and action. While there is no predetermined length or format for the Personal Statement of Faith, the norm is a one page narrative document describing the applicant's central Christian beliefs, significant formative influences in the applicant's Christian experience (e.g., religious experiences of conversion or the affirmation of one's faith, one's family and/or home life, spiritual aspirations), and ways in which the applicant's faith is being demonstrated in daily patterns and practices.
